The understanding Window Glass Seal Restoration
The most frequent windows problems today is fog or cloudy glass. Double-paned windows are likely to have this problem when the seal between them fails. This seal is responsible for keeping moisture and air from the space that is insulated. If it breaks, then condensation could develop in the glass unit. This results in less insulation and poor visibility.
Window glass restoration is the replacement of a failed insulated-glass unit, while retaining the original frame. A new sealed unit replaces the previous glass. This increases clarity, boosts the thermal performance, and gets rid of the moisture trapped.
Seal replacement directly impacts energy efficiency. When the seal fails temperatures can escape in winter and come back in the summer making HVAC systems work harder. Once the seal is fixed, the temperature inside stabilizes and energy loss is reduced. Comfort levels also increase. This translates into lower costs for energy and less strain on cooling and heating systems.
What is Insulated Window Glass Services Can Do for You?
The services of a professional glass-insulated window repair service go beyond repairing windows. Homeowners can enhance their windows using the latest glass technologies. The glass is insulating and enhanced with Low-E coatings and gas called argon.
Low-E glass (low emissivity) reflective of sunlight and allows natural light to enter. This means that homes are kept warm in the colder months, but cooler in the summer. UV protection can help prevent the fading of furniture, artwork, and flooring caused by prolonged exposure to sunlight.
Another significant benefit of insulated glass is the sound reduction. Double-paned glass can be a sound barrier that makes houses more peaceful and quiet. This is especially important for properties near busy roads and schools as well as commercial areas.

The Environmental and Financial Benefits of Glass-Only Solutions
The financial aspect is that a glass-only replacement is more affordable than a full replacement. In order to install new window frames, you must removal of the old frames, repairing the walls, removing the old material and paying for repair work at the factory. Many of these expenses can be reduced through replacement of the glass.
Most homeowners who use professional window glass service save hundreds of dollars or even thousands of dollars while receiving the same level of performance. Visually, the result is identical windows that look contemporary and clear.
There is also a substantial environmental advantage. Removal of existing glass and keeping it in place reduces the amount of waste generated during construction. This is in line with sustainable building techniques and reduces carbon footprint of renovations.
Security is another major benefit. Families, especially animals and children, are at risk of damage or broken glass. Contemporary replacement glass is usually tempered or laminated, making it safer and stronger as older glass types. If it does break, it shatters into small, less harmful pieces.
